Human flights to Mars still at least 15 years off: ESA head

Wednesday, June 22, 2016 - 08:50 in Astronomy & Space

DARMSTADT, Germany (Reuters) - Dreaming of a trip to Mars? You'll have to wait at least 15 years for the technology to be developed, the head of the European Space Agency (ESA) said, putting doubt on claims that the journey could happen sooner.
